What is a Registered Agent? A designated agent is an individual or a business entity designated to accept legal documents on for a business or limited liability company (LLC). Also referred to as the service of process agent, the registered agent ensures that important legal and tax documents are delivered and managed in a prompt manner. This role is crucial for maintaining compliance with state regulations and keeping that a business remains in good standing. In numerous jurisdictions, having a designated agent is a legal requirement for corporations and LLCs. The registered agent must have a physical address in the state where the business is formed, and they must be reachable during standard business hours to receive service of process and official correspondence. This service can provide peace of mind for business owners, knowing that they will be notified to any legal matters that may arise. Using a professional registered agent services provider can offer additional benefits, such as increased privacy and confidentiality. Instead of using a personal address for public records, businesses can utilize the registered agent’s address, which helps maintain a degree of separation between personal and business matters. In addition, many registered agent companies offer additional features like compliance reminders and annual report filing services, making them invaluable partners in handling business obligations efficiently. Authorized Agent Costs Explained As considering registered agent solutions, grasping the costs associated is vital for businesses. The costs associated with contracting a registered agent can differ widely based on the company and the features offered. Typically, the cost can range from around $50 to $500 annually, depending on the nature of the services provided. Elements affecting these costs include if the registered agent is a local company or a large provider, the degree of assistance, and any extra features included in the service package. Some registered agent companies offer cost-effective options that may feature basic compliance reminders and document handling, while others provide additional comprehensive services, such as annual compliance filings and corporate governance support. Additionally, businesses should be aware of any potential hidden fees, such as costs for service of process delivery or document retrieval. Understanding the full extent of registered agent costs will guarantee that businesses choose a vendor that meets their needs free from unexpected financial burdens.
